Transaction d9ada59d99839b7aae8d33953339501fa67eab14f0ba2445ef94d343a02f647b
1 Input
1 Output
-
d9ada59d99839b7aae8d33953339501fa67eab14f0ba2445ef94d343a02f647b:0
- value
- 45628037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1dd180e4f884b249e74d862f27f05b02ceca78ee OP_EQUAL
- address
- 34QgVfWaCxvpxekqmuq7pre7rYq2hu5fxM